Kia Telluride Recall Over Fire Risk | Sacramento News 09.07.2026 1:32
Kia’s recalling nearly 463,000 Telluride SUVs from 2020 to 2024 due to a fire risk linked to the front power seat motor — if the slide knob sticks or a prior fix was incomplete, the motor can overheat. NHTSA urges owners to park vehicles outside away from buildings until repairs are made. Michigan Faces Largest Cyclospora Outbreak | Sacramento News 09.07.2026 1:42
Michigan is facing its largest-ever cyclospora outbreak, with nearly 1,000 cases reported — a microscopic parasite causing severe watery diarrhea and lingering symptoms. The bug, often linked to contaminated produce like salads and raspberries, has also spread to Ohio, Illinois, and New York.
